Product Description

by Linda Stamm (Author), Joan Clipp (Illustrator)

Ruby's mom tells her the wonderfully unique story of how she came into being through sperm donation. Along the way, Ruby learns about how her mom sought the help of a sperm donor and doctor, as well as the ultimate good news of her birth into a warm and loving family.

From the Author

Progress in medical science and assisted reproductive technology (ART) have for some time enabled couples to have a genetic connection with their children through the use of a sperm donor. Although such technology can readily help single parents, as well, there is still strong social stigma in some communities for single mothers who want to build a new family on their own. Nevertheless, a growing number of women are doing so.

Limited resources exist to help single mothers engage in open and honest discussions on how their children came to be. It is my hope that Ruby & Mommy will be used as a tool to begin this very important dialogue. This book is a tribute to women who make the choice to share their life and love with a child.
